Self-Marketing Is A Full-Time Job

 

The most important aspect of being an entrepreneur or small business owner is self-marketing. Self marketing, in itself, is a full time job. And, for a bootstrapped entrepreneur it is a full-time job even more so. Luckily, there are plenty of entrepreneur resources to help you through it to self-market yourself, the best and most popular being the Guerrilla Marketing series of books by Jay Conrad Levinson. Guerrilla Marketing is defined by Wikipedia as an "unconventional way of performing marketing activities (primarily promotion) on a very low budget."

When entrepreneurs deal with self-marketing on a low budget they must realize that there is not one golden technique that they could perform that will draw loads of new business their way. New entrepreneurs and small business owners must perform a variety of marketing activities because no one marketing tactic on its own will be enough. That is why self-marketing is a full time job.

With that in mind, here are just a few self-marketing techniques that a new entrepreneur should do. If you are a new entrepreneur, dont do just one. Do them all and more.

  • Article Writing: Write expert articles in your area of expertise and submit them to article directories. The most important directory you can submit to is EzineArticles.com. At the bottom of each article that you write you can include a link to your website (if you have one), your business phone number, or an email address. The most important thing to realize with articles is that most people will find your article via a search engine such as Google, Yahoo, or MSN. And, most of the search engines will give you a ranking based on the title of the article. You must make the title keyword rich; use words that you think people searching for your services will type into the search box. Don't write just one article; write plenty.

  • Internet Sales Leads: You can purchase executive contact names and phone numbers from leads list companies like InfoUSA and D&B. Or you can receive free B2B and B2C sales leads from Trade-Pals.com. There is a TradePals category for most business professionals like accountants, advertising & marketing professionals, insurance brokers, real estate brokers, lawyers, engineers, website designers, sales consultants, motivational speakers, financial planners, and writers, for example. When creating a profile remember that, just like EzineArticles.com, most people will find your profile via a search engine so it is important to create a descriptive profile, especially the "brief overview of services" section.

  • Free Publicity: Free publicity could be the best advertising that you and your business could receive. The media's reach is wide and far. You could try meeting with editors of local newspapers or even news stations. You could send relevant press releases, as long as they are newsworthy. Don't believe the hype that a press release can get you instant publicity. You must realize that the media receive thousands of press releases daily; they don't even read most of them. But again, you must try everything when self-marketing yourself including writing a press release. There are online press release services like PRWeb.com and Send2Press.com.

  • Business Networking: Business networking could be an inexpensive way to learn from other entrepreneurs, to make business contacts, or to receive business referrals. You could join your local Chamber of Commerce or your local BNI (Business Networking International) chapter. As well, there are online business networking websites such as Ryze.com and LinkedIn.com.
